Overview Of Position
The Senior Corporate Dietitian, as a nutrition subject matter expert in OPTAVIA programs, plans and products, development of plan relevant recipes, conducting plan and product nutritional assessments and analysis, supports brand integrity by contributing to development of relevant FAQs, marketing collaterals and training of internal and external customers. The Senior Corporate Dietitian creates and manages program, plan and product nutrition knowledge base for consistency of brand message across Medifast/OPTAVIA, increasing the lifetime value of our coaches and clients. This position also represents the department and leads key initiatives to identify coach and client needs to create nutrition program materials to improve coach and client confidence and success and promote healthy habit development.
Job Responsibilities
- Manage recipe projects by developing, testing and analyzing program appropriate recipes. Develop best practices, strategy, communication campaign and create monthly, quarterly and annual metrics summary. Coordinate sharing of recipes via OPTAVIA APP and ensure robustness and quality of information.
- Represent Medifast/OPTAVIA at PR events, trainings, professional events and conventions, as well as through various media channels (e.g., social networks, broadcast and print media, etc.), consistently conveying, evidenced-based messaging to support clients and coaches. Identify key conferences to attend and opportunities to support the vision and mission of the company.
- Manage internally- and externally facing nutrition knowledge databases, FAQs, marketing assets, social media, and websites to ensure accuracy and consistency of messaging, across all markets.
- Manage, identify and create and/or revise targeted nutrition program guides to meet business needs and support the success of both coaches and clients. Lead revision and implementation process for the department by working with stakeholders in other departments, including marketing, legal, Scientific and Clinical Affairs and IT, to revise, train and implement client and coach facing materials for accuracy, up-to-date and consistent messaging.
- Create, manage and deliver training modules on programs, products and nutrition protocol that are relevant to the OPTAVIA model and promote coach and client competence and confidence. Training will target both domestic and international markets.
- Contribute to the design and advise on nutritional aspects of new products and programs; provide educational materials and collateral to promote the safe and effective use of the products/programs.
- Manage process for supporting high profile clients, (i.e. coach leaders, celebrities, bloggers) with marketing to ensure demonstrated success on the program.
- Take lead on proactively mentoring new Nutrition and Wellness team members and assisting with training Nutrition Support team members.
- Maintain occasional support of clients and coaches via Nutrition Support during high volume times.
Knowledge, Education, Skills & Abilities
- Minimum: Bachelor’s degree in nutrition, health sciences or related field. (minimum)
- Highly Desired: Master’s degree in nutrition, health sciences or related field. (highly desired)
- Required: 5-10 years experience in a nutrition, health sciences or related field.
- Required: Registered Dietitian with the Academy of Nutrition and Dietetics and/or Licensed Dietitian/Nutritionist.
- Highly Desired: Culinary experience and interest.
- Ability to work with confidential customer and company information.
- Working knowledge of computer software including Microsoft Office, Nutrient Analysis software like Genesis.
- Ability to travel up to 25%.
